Meon Road, Basingstoke house prices
In Meon Road, Basingstoke, the median price a home actually changed hands for is £176,250. Over the past decade prices are +43% in cash — but −2% once inflation is stripped out.

Meon Road, Basingstoke house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Meon Road, Basingstoke?
The median sold price in Meon Road, Basingstoke is £176,250, based on 38 recorded sales from HM Land Registry.
What is the price range of homes sold in Meon Road, Basingstoke?
Recorded sales in Meon Road, Basingstoke range from £64,000 to £460,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Meon Road, Basingstoke risen?
Over the past decade prices in Meon Road, Basingstoke are +43% in cash terms but −2%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Meon Road, Basingstoke was 31 January 2025.
